Altered Lung Environment:

Dampened Responses to Allergen

Key Findings:

• Persistent changes resulted in a reduction in

the overall inflammatory response to allergen

challenge in the lungs of Nb-infected animals

• Distinct gene expression profiles in the lungs

of NbHDM vs HDM mice

• Lower fold-increase of transcription of Th1 &

Th2 cytokines in NbHDM mice

• Resistance in the airways is significantly

depressed in the lungs of NbHDM mice
